Industry Evolution and Consumer Trends

Historically rooted in land-based casino floors, slot games transitioned into the digital realm with the advent of internet gambling in the late 1990s. Early online slots borrowed heavily from their physical counterparts — simple mechanics, traditional themes, and basic graphics. However, recent years have seen a profound shift towards more sophisticated, immersive experiences that leverage multi-platform accessibility and advanced technologies like HTML5, augmented reality (AR), and gamification techniques.

For example, a recent report by the European Gaming and Betting Association highlights that in 2022, online slots accounted for approximately 70% of all digital gambling revenue across Europe, underscoring their popularity and importance within the sector. This rapid growth has prompted developers to innovate continuously, blending entertainment and engagement with responsible gambling features.

Technological Innovations Driving the Sector

Key Technological Advancements in Digital Slot Gaming
Innovation Description Industry Impact
HTML5 and Cross-Platform Play Modern slots leverage HTML5, allowing seamless play across devices without downloading additional software. Expands accessibility, enhances user engagement, and reduces development costs for operators.
Gamification and Social Features Incorporating leaderboards, rewards, and interactive storytelling to boost retention. Makes slots more engaging, fostering community and prolonged play sessions.
Provably Fair Technology Uses cryptographic algorithms to verify game fairness for players. Increases transparency and builds trust within the users’ community.
AR/VR Integration Augmented and virtual reality features elevate the immersive quality of games. Sets a new standard for realism and player immersion, particularly in high-end markets.
